2009-06-12module: trim exception table on init free.Rusty Russell
It's theoretically possible that there are exception table entries which point into the (freed) init text of modules. These could cause future problems if other modules get loaded into that memory and cause an exception as we'd see the wrong fixup. The only case I know of is kvm-intel.ko (when CONFIG_CC_OPTIMIZE_FOR_SIZE=n). Amerigo fixed this long-standing FIXME in the x86 version, but this patch is more general. This implements trim_init_extable(); most archs are simple since they use the standard lib/extable.c sort code. Alpha and IA64 use relative addresses in their fixups, so thier trimming is a slight variation. Sparc32 is unique; it doesn't seem to define ARCH_HAS_SORT_EXTABLE, yet it defines its own sort_extable() which overrides the one in lib. It doesn't sort, so we have to mark deleted entries instead of actually trimming them. 2009-06-12Blackfin: make deferred hardware errors more exactRobin Getz
Hardware errors on the Blackfin architecture are queued by nature of the hardware design. Things that could generate a hardware level queue up at the system interface and might not process until much later, at which point the system would send a notification back to the core. As such, it is possible for user space code to do something that would trigger a hardware error, but have it delay long enough for the process context to switch. So when the hardware error does signal, we mistakenly evaluate it as a different process or as kernel context and panic (erp!). This makes it pretty difficult to find the offending context. But wait, there is good news somewhere. By forcing a SSYNC in the interrupt entry, we force all pending queues at the system level to be processed and all hardware errors to be signaled. Then we check the current interrupt state to see if the hardware error is now signaled. If so, we re-queue the current interrupt and return thus allowing the higher priority hardware error interrupt to process properly. Since we haven't done any other context processing yet, the right context will be selected and killed. There is still the possibility that the exact offending instruction will be unknown, but at least we'll have a much better idea of where to look. The downside of course is that this causes system-wide syncs at every interrupt point which results in significant performance degradation. Since this situation should not occur in any properly configured system (as hardware errors are triggered by things like bad pointers), make it a debug configuration option and disable it by default. 2009-06-12Blackfin: fix early L1 relocation crashRobin Getz
Our early L1 relocate code may implicitly call code which lives in L1 memory. This is due to the dma_memcpy() rewrite that made the DMA code lockless and safe to be used by multiple processes. If we start the early DMA memcpy to relocate things into L1 instruction but then our DMA memcpy code calls a function that lives in L1, things fall apart. As such, create a small dedicated DMA memcpy routine that we can assume sanity at boot time.
